Knot

Take the ends and pass them
Left over right,
Then under, round, and through,
And pull them tight,
And friction does the rest
Between the coils, between the strands,
And even between the fibres –
Like a thousand tiny hands
That hold us back
And stop the world from unravelling.
Sometimes it feels like we’re held in place
By nothing but well-bound string.
